body {
margin:0;
padding:0;
font-family: "Trebuchet MS", Arial, Tahoma, Verdana, Helvetica, sans-serif;
font-size: 11px;
line-height: 14px;
font-weight: normal;
color: #333333;
}

.mooter 	    { font-family: Arial, Helvetica, sans-serif; font-size: 10px; color: #565656; font-style: normal; }

/* ------- ajax style --------- */
* {
    font-family: Verdana, Helvetica;
    font-size: 10pt;
}
.highslide-html {
    background-color: white;
}
.highslide-html-blur {
}
.highslide-html-content {
	position: absolute;
    display: none;
}
.highslide-loading {
    display: block;
	color: black;
	font-size: 8pt;
	font-family: sans-serif;
	font-weight: bold;
    text-decoration: none;
	padding: 2px;
	border: 1px solid black;
    background-color: white;

    padding-left: 22px;
    background-image: url(../plugin/highslide/graphics/loader.white.gif);
    background-repeat: no-repeat;
    background-position: 3px 1px;
}
a.highslide-credits,
a.highslide-credits i {
    padding: 2px;
    color: silver;
    text-decoration: none;
	font-size: 10px;
}
a.highslide-credits:hover,
a.highslide-credits:hover i {
    color: white;
    background-color: gray;
}


/* Styles for the popup */
.highslide-wrapper {
	background-color: white;
}
.highslide-wrapper .highslide-html-content {
    width: 400px;
    padding: 5px;
}
.highslide-wrapper .highslide-header div {
}
.highslide-wrapper .highslide-header ul {
	margin: 0;
	padding: 0;
	text-align: right;
}
.highslide-wrapper .highslide-header ul li {
	display: inline;
	padding-left: 1em;
}
.highslide-wrapper .highslide-header ul li.highslide-previous, .highslide-wrapper .highslide-header ul li.highslide-next {
	display: none;
}
.highslide-wrapper .highslide-header a {
	font-weight: bold;
	color: gray;
	text-transform: uppercase;
	text-decoration: none;
}
.highslide-wrapper .highslide-header a:hover {
	color: black;
}
.highslide-wrapper .highslide-header .highslide-move a {
	cursor: move;
}
.highslide-wrapper .highslide-footer {
	height: 11px;
}
.highslide-wrapper .highslide-footer .highslide-resize {
	float: right;
	height: 11px;
	width: 11px;
	background: url(../plugin/highslide/graphics/resize.gif);
}
.highslide-wrapper .highslide-body {
}
.highslide-move {
    cursor: move;
}
.highslide-resize {
    cursor: nw-resize;
}

/* These must be the last of the Highslide rules */
.highslide-display-block {
    display: block;
}
.highslide-display-none {
    display: none;
}
/* ------- end of ajax style --------- */

/*global link style*/
a:link{ 
color:#a51ce5;
text-decoration:none; 
}

a:hover{ 
color:#333333;
text-decoration:none; 
}

a:active{ 
color:#a51ce5; 
text-decoration:none; 
}

a:active:hover{ 
color:#333333; 
text-decoration:none; 
}

a:visited{ 
color:#a51ce5; 
text-decoration:none; 
}

a:visited:hover{ 
color:#333333; 
text-decoration:none; 
}

/*headerwrap - member page*/
.wrapmember3{
margin:0;
padding:0;
background: #666666 url(../images/bg-tile03.jpg) repeat-x left top;
}
/*headerwrap - member page*/

/*flash-member page---*/
#memsplash3{
position: absolute;
z-index: 5;
top: 0;
left: 5px;
width: 200px;
height: 50px;
background-color: transparent;
}
/*---flash-member page*/

/*content-wraper*/
#content-tiga{
clear: both;
font-family: "Trebuchet MS", Arial, Tahoma, Verdana, Helvetica, sans-serif;
font-size: 12px;
line-height: 14px;
color: #000000;
margin: 0 0 10px 0;
padding: 0;
overflow: hidden;
background-color: transparent;
}

#wrap{
margin:0 0 15px 0;
padding: 0 4px;
}

/*content-wraper*/

#rightcol{
width: 13%;
float:right;
margin-top: 15px;
padding:0;
overflow: hidden;
background: #ffffff url(../images/right-tile_03a.jpg) no-repeat left top;
}

#leftcol{
margin-top: 40px;
width: 86%;
float:left;
padding:0;
overflow: hidden;
background: #ffffff url(../images/left-tile_03b.jpg) no-repeat right bottom;
}

/*inpooooo---*/
.anu{
	margin-top: 8px;
	margin-bottom:8px;
	padding: 0 10px;
	overflow: hidden;
	vertical-align:middle;
	display: block;
	clear: both;
	font-family: Arial, Tahoma, Verdana, Helvetica, sans-serif;
	font-size: 14px;
	line-height: 16px;
	width:auto;
	height: 16px;
	font-weight: bold;
	text-align: left;
	color: #990000;
	background-color: transparent;
}
/*---inpoooooo*/

.infopage3{
display: block;
margin: 0;
padding: 0 0 0 10px;
height: 20px;
line-height: 20px;
font-size: 14px;
font-weight: normal;
font-style:italic;
font-family: Arial, Tahoma, sans-serif;
text-align: left;
color: #339966;
border-bottom: 1px dotted #666666;
background: #ffffff url(../images/left-tile_03a.jpg) no-repeat right top;
}

/*---member main-nav*/
#membernav3{
margin-top:15px;
padding: 0 10px 10px 0;
line-height: 18px;
font-weight: normal;
color: #333333;
background: #ffffff url(../images/right-tile_03b.jpg) no-repeat left bottom;
}

#membernav3 a{
display: block;
font-family: Trebuchet MS, Arial, Tahoma, Verdana, Helvetica, sans-serif;
font-size: 12px;
line-height: 18px;
font-weight: bold;
color: #339966;
text-decoration:none;
padding-right: 15px;
background-color: transparent;
}

#membernav3 a:hover{
color: #333333;
display: block;
text-align:left;
padding-left: 10px;
text-decoration:none;
background: #f1f1f1 url(../images/list-img2a.gif) no-repeat left center;
}

#membernav3 ul{
font-size: 12px;
margin:0;
padding:0;
list-style-type: none;
}

#membernav3 li{
display: block;
margin: 4px 0 0 0;
color: #999999;
text-align:right;
padding-left: 10px;
text-decoration:none;
list-style-type: none;
vertical-align: middle;
/*background-color: transparent;*/
background: transparent url(../images/list-img3.gif) no-repeat right 4px;
}
/*member main-nav---*/

/*footer---*/
.footer3{
margin-top: 10px;
padding: 2px 10px;
overflow: hidden;
display: block;
clear: both;
font-family: "Trebuchet MS", Arial, Tahoma, Verdana, Helvetica, sans-serif;
font-size: 10px;
line-height: 14px;
font-weight: normal;
text-align: center;
color: #ffffff;
border-top: 1px dotted #999999;
background-color: transparent;
}
/*---footer*/


.head-tr1{/*biru-ungu*/
margin: 0;
padding: 5px;
vertical-align: middle;
color: #ffffff;
font-size: 11px;
font-weight: normal;
text-align: left;
background-color: #7171db;
}

.head-td3{/*ijo soft*/
margin: 0;
padding: 2px;
vertical-align: middle;
background-color: #fbffeb;
}

.head-td4{/*ungu.muda1*/
margin: 0;
padding: 2px;
color: #000000;
font-size: 11px;
font-weight: normal;
vertical-align: middle;
background-color: #e1e1ff;
}

.head-td5{/*ungu.muda2*/
margin: 0;
padding: 2px;
color: #000000;
font-size: 11px;
font-weight: normal;
vertical-align: middle;
background-color: #f8f8ff;
}

.head-td6{/*ijo.soft2*/
margin: 0;
padding: 2px;
color: #000000;
font-size: 11px;
font-weight: normal;
vertical-align: middle;
background-color: #ecffeb;
}

.tra1{
overflow: hidden;
color: #009900;
line-height: 14px;
background-color: #F4F4FF;
margin: 0;
padding: 3px 0;
}

H1 	{
	color: black;
	font-size: medium;
	font-weight: normal;
	font-family: arial, sans-serif ;
	font-style: normal;
}

H2 	{
	color: black;
	font-size: small;
	font-weight: normal;
	font-family: arial, sans-serif ;
	font-style: normal;
}

.buttonijo {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 9pt;
	background-color: #CCFFCC;
	font-weight: bold;
	border-top-width: 1px;
	border-right-width: 1px;
	border-bottom-width: 1px;
	border-left-width: 1px;
	border-style: left-style;
	cursor: hand;
}

.buttonkuning {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 8.2pt;
	background-color: #FFFFBB;
	font-weight: bold;
	border-top-width: 1px;
	border-right-width: 1px;
	border-bottom-width: 1px;
	border-left-width: 1px;
	border-style: solid;
	border-color: #338822;
	cursor: hand;
}

.buttonpink {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 8.2pt;
	background-color: #FFDDDD;
	font-weight: bold;
	border-top-width: 1px;
	border-right-width: 1px;
	border-bottom-width: 1px;
	border-left-width: 1px;
	border-style: solid;
	border-color: #CC6666;
	cursor: hand;
}

.buttonbiru {
background-color: #EFEFFF;
border-color: #8888EE;
border-style: left-style;
font-weight: bold;
border-width: 1;
border-top-width: 1px;
border-right-width: 1px;
border-bottom-width: 1px;
border-left-width: 1px;
color: #000000;
font-size: 8pt;
font-family: arial;
cursor: hand;
}

.outputbiruboxnoborder {
	background-color: #ffffcc;
	overflow: auto;
	color: #68451f;
	font-size: 8pt;
	font-family: arial;
	font-style: italic;
	cursor: default;
	border: 2px inset #999933;
	padding: 2px;
}

.mainmenu 		{ 
color: #FF0000; 
font-family: Arial, Helvetica, sans-serif; 
font-size: smaller; 
text-decoration: none; 
font-weight: bold; 
}

.judul 		{ 
color: #FF0000; 
font-family: Arial, Helvetica, sans-serif; 
font-size: small; 
text-decoration: none; 
font-weight: bold; 
}

.submenu 		{ 
color: #BB6666; 
font-family: Arial, Helvetica, sans-serif; 
font-size: smaller; 
text-decoration: none; 
font-weight: bold; 
}

.sidemenu 		{ 
color: #CCCCCC; 
font-family: Arial, Helvetica, sans-serif; 
font-size: smaller; 
font-style: normal; 
text-decoration: none; 
font-weight: bold
}

.input	{ 
border-color:#000000; 
border-width:1;	
font-family:Arial, Helvetica; 
font-size:12;	
background-color:#FFFFFF; 
color:#000000; 
}

.select	{ 
border-color:#000000;	
border-width:1;	
font-family:Arial, Helvetica; 
font-size:12;	
color:#000000; 
background-color:#FFFFFF; 
}

.textarea {	
border-color:#000000; 
border-width:1; 
font-family:Arial, Helvetica;	
font-size:12; color:#000000; 
background-color:#FFFFFF;	
}

.badag {	
border-color:#000000; 
border-width:1; 
font-family:Arial, Helvetica;	
font-size:12; color:#000000; 
background-color:#99FF66; 
font-weight: bold; 
}

.inputbiru {  
font-family: Arial, Helvetica, sans-serif; 
font-size: 8pt; 
background-color: #FFFFAA; 
border-style: solid; 
border-color: #DDDD00; 
cursor:hand; 
}

.inputputih {  
font-family: Arial, Helvetica, sans-serif; 
font-size: 8pt; 
border-style: none;
}

.linkputih {  
color: #FFFFFF; 
text-decoration: none;
}

a.linkputih:hover {  
color: #FF0000; 
text-decoration: underline;
}

.linkhitam {  
color: #000000; 
text-decoration: none;
}

a.linkhitam:hover {  
color: #FF0000; 
text-decoration: underline;
}

.linkkuning {  
text-decoration: none;
}

a.linkkuning:hover {  
color: #FFFFFF; 
text-decoration: underline;
}

a.linkkuning:link {  
color: #FF6600; 
text-decoration: none;
}

a.linkkuning:visited {  
color: #FF6600; 
text-decoration: none;
}

.terang {  
font-family: Arial, Helvetica, sans-serif; 
color: #CCCCCC; 
text-decoration: none;  
font-weight: bold; 	
font-size: 8.4pt;
}

a.terang:hover  { 
font-family: Arial, Helvetica, sans-serif;  
color: #FFFFCC; 
text-decoration: underline overline; 
font-weight: bold; 	
font-size: 8.4pt;
}

a.terang:active { 
font-family: Arial, Helvetica, sans-serif;  
color: #FFFFFF; 
text-decoration: none; 
font-weight: bold;	
font-size: 8.4pt; 
background-color: #FF597F;
}

.gelap {   
font-family: Arial, Helvetica, sans-serif; 
color: #000000; 
text-decoration: none;  
font-weight: bold; 	
font-size: 8.4pt; 
padding: 1px;
}

a.gelap:hover {  
font-family: Arial, Helvetica, sans-serif; 
color: #000066; 
text-decoration: underline overline; 
font-weight: bold; 	
font-size: 8.4pt;
}

li {
background: #fff;
}

a.gelap:active {  
font-family: Arial, Helvetica, sans-serif; 
color: #FFFFFF; 
text-decoration: none; 
font-weight: bold; 	
font-size: 8.4pt; 
background-color: #FF597F;
}

#navigation ul {
margin: 0; 
width: 150px; 
font: bold 10px Verdana; 
list-style: none;
}

#navigation ul li {
margin: 0; 
padding: 0; 
text-align: right;
}

#navigation ul li a {
display: block; 
width: 150px; 
height: 25px; 
line-height: 25px;
color: #fff; 
font-weight: bold;
border-bottom: solid 1px #000;
}

#navigation a:link, #navigation a:visited {
background-color: #DC234D;
}
#navigation a:hover, #navigation a:active {
background-color: #FF597F;
}
#navigation ul li a span {
padding-right: 10px;
}
#navigation a.current {
background-color: transparent;
}